St. André has a typical Mediterranean climate with predictable seasonal weather. The long hot summers and short cooler winters are both dry seasons. More rain falls in the brief spring and autumn. Although predominantly balmy, there can occasionally be winds and summer storms. The winds are known as the Mistral , the Tramontane and the Marin. When the Mistral blows gently in the summer, it creates idylic sunny days. According to the locals, the fine dry weather starts in mid April and continues until the end of August, in mid September there are some windy days, in early November the cold dry weather of winter starts. February is the coldest month.
